Questions and Answers

What is the cheapest way to get from Wandsworth to Portsmouth?

The cheapest way to get from Wandsworth to Portsmouth is to drive which costs $21.74 - $32.61 and takes 1h 15m.

What is the fastest way to get from Wandsworth to Portsmouth?

The fastest way to get from Wandsworth to Portsmouth is to drive which takes 1h 15m and costs $21.74 - $32.61 .

Is there a direct bus between Wandsworth and Portsmouth?

No, there is no direct bus from Wandsworth to Portsmouth. However, there are services departing from Upper Richmond Road and arriving at Portsmouth via London Victoria.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 5m.

Is there a direct train between Wandsworth and Portsmouth?

No, there is no direct train from Wandsworth station to Portsmouth. However, there are services departing from East Putney station and arriving at Portsmouth & Southsea via Wimbledon and Woking.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 11m.

How far is it from Wandsworth to Portsmouth?

The distance between Wandsworth and Portsmouth is 111 km. The road distance is 112 km.

How do I travel from Wandsworth to Portsmouth without a car?

The best way to get from Wandsworth to Portsmouth without a car is to train via Woking which takes 2h 11m and costs $40.22 - $97.83 .

How long does it take to get from Wandsworth to Portsmouth?

It takes approximately 2h 11m to get from Wandsworth to Portsmouth, including transfers.
